About Wheatland

Wheatland is a Wheatland, California school district serving 4 schools. The district educates 1,333 students with a student-teacher ratio of 19.3:1. The district invests $18,818 per student annually.

With an average rating of 7.7/10, Wheatland is among the strongest-performing districts in the state.

The highest-rated school in the district is Wheatland Charter Academy, which has a composite score of 9.2/10.

In standardized testing, Wheatland students show an average math proficiency of 48.7% and ELA proficiency of 53.4%.

The district includes 3 elementary schools , 1 middle school .
